Overview

Fired from his band and hard up for cash, guitarist and vocalist Dewey Finn finagles his way into a job as a fifth-grade substitute teacher at a private school, where he secretly begins teaching his students the finer points of rock 'n' roll. The school's hard-nosed principal is rightly suspicious of Finn's activities. But Finn's roommate remains in the dark about what he's doing.

Summary

"School of Rock - He just landed the gig of his life: 5th grade." is english Language Movie.

"School of Rock" was released on 03 October 2003 it had a budget of $35,000,000 and had box office collection of $131,100,000.

The movie was directed by Richard Linklater
